【liteos 华为 源码】【晴天代挂网源码】【标准燕窝溯源码】EulerOS源码
1.EulerOSԴ??
2.openeuler系统优缺点分析
3.openeuler操作系统详细介绍
4.Linux神器strace的使用方法及实践
5.FFmpeg开发笔记(七)欧拉系统编译安装FFmpeg
6.openeuler是否基于linux详情
EulerOSԴ??
华为,凭借其鸿蒙和欧拉操作系统,实现了在数字基础设施领域的重大突破,成为业界瞩目的焦点。这一成就不仅凸显了华为在科技领域的实力,也深刻揭示了华为生态战略的liteos 华为 源码深远意义。
华为的操作系统布局分为两大核心:鸿蒙和欧拉。鸿蒙操作系统,以其面向智能终端、互联网和工业终端的定位,致力于解决多设备互联与协同难题,成为华为面向C端市场的“自救”之举。而欧拉操作系统,则偏重于基础架构,覆盖服务器、边缘计算、云和嵌入式等领域,是华为向B端市场的主动“进击”。这两个系统看似独立,却在一个大生态中互相关联和牵扯,共同在数字化革新中发挥着至关重要的作用。
鸿蒙操作系统自推出以来,已经经历了多次迭代升级,从最初的破冰重见光明,到现在的“纯血鸿蒙”版本,华为在鸿蒙OS中融入了对安卓生态的完全独立化,使其在技术架构上领先全球。鸿蒙OS已经成为全球第三大手机操作系统,稳坐国产第一大手机操作系统之位。通过华为的“鸿飞计划”,投入巨额资金支持开发者,使得鸿蒙原生应用开发队伍壮大,包括美团、晴天代挂网源码去哪儿、新浪、支付宝、米哈游等互联网大厂在内的众多企业加入,进一步推动了鸿蒙生态的繁荣。
欧拉操作系统作为华为在服务器操作系统领域的代表作,其定位更趋全面,面向数字基础设施的全场景。从EulerOS的内部研发,到面向服务器、通信和实时操作系统的多场景支持,再到与全球头部开源基金会的合作,欧拉操作系统在短短四年时间内,从“独”到“众”,实现了规模化的商业应用和全球下载量的突破。如今,欧拉操作系统市场份额名列中国服务器操作系统第一,成为名副其实的中国第一服务器操作系统。
华为生态战略的成功,不仅在于其操作系统产品的创新和市场应用,更在于其对开源文化的拥抱与推动。华为通过开放源代码,不仅吸引了全球开发者参与,还构建了全球性的开源生态,为推动数字经济时代的基础建设和技术底座的建立贡献了力量。华为的成功证明了,在科技领域,开放合作与共享共赢是推动产业发展的关键,也是实现长远繁荣的基石。
openeuler系统优缺点分析
open euler系统优缺点分析?
优点:
1、满足开放性:开放源码的设计,公开认可的标准燕窝溯源码API文档,让开发者能够方便快捷的获取他们所需要的组件;
2、实时性:支持Kubernetes、Openstack,以及大规模分布式系统;
3、支持多语言:支持多种语言编程,包括Java、Go、Python;
4、安全可靠:严格的安全策略,满足复杂的企业级安全情景;
5、多样化的产品:涵盖了云原生、大数据、AI、IoT、区块链等多种技术场景。
缺点:
1、有时更新太慢:EulerOS的更新速度,相比CentOS或者Debian,有些用户反应慢了一些;
2、运行效率不高:运行效率主要取决于硬件、应用以及系统版本,但是EulerOS的效率综合指数还不够高;
3、技术支持不足:EulerOS是一个较新的系统,目前技术支持仍不够成熟,对于一些复杂的技术问题,可能需要更多的社区支持。
openeuler操作系统详细介绍
鸿蒙大家都已经非常熟悉了,现在从华为计算官方放出额最新消息显示,华为计划于9月日发布全新的操作系统openEuler欧拉,同时消息中提到,任正非表示欧拉正在大踏步地前进,欧拉的网吧离线源码定位是瞄准国家数字基础设施的操作系统和生态底座。
在我们平时的手机操作系统中,一般都是安卓系统以及ios系统,这两种系统是最多用户在使用的有关华为将发布新操作系统openEuler欧拉,此举有何深意我以为并没有什么意思,都是为了用户服务,大致有以下的原因华为在此前。
首先,我们在Mac系统中点击dock栏中的启动台,在启动台的界面窗口中找到已经安装好的虚拟器VirtualBox紧接着,我们需要通过VirtualBox去挂载openEuler LTSiso文件,具体设置方法如下1打开VirtualBox界面中的。
9月日,华为在全联接大会上正式发布面向数字基础设施的开源操作系统欧拉openEuler华为称,欧拉操作系统可广泛部署于服务器云计算边缘计算嵌入式等各种形态设备,应用场景覆盖ITInformation TechnologyCTCommun。
openEuler 项目来源于华为服务器操作系统 EulerOS, 年 9 月 日宣布开源,华为宣布开放 openEuler 源码,源码托管于 Gitee 平台华为开发者大会 Cloud上,华为发布 openEuler LTS 版本,并与麒麟软件。
在本次会议上,华为携手社区全体伙伴共同将欧拉开源操作系统openEuler, 简称“欧拉”正式捐赠给开放原子开源基金会据介绍,欧拉是数字基础设施的开源操作系统,可广泛部署于服务器云计算边缘计算嵌入式等各种形态设备。
据介绍华为欧拉openEuler操作系统是基于CentOS开源系统构建开发而成相信华为当初华为选择全球开源的CentOS为基础进行深度开发,也是有其考虑,国内在服务器领域采用CentOS红帽系的系统占据绝大部分,CentOS系操作系统都提供长达年。
Linux神器strace的使用方法及实践
在Linux系统中,strace这个强大的cf透视源码2017工具如神器般实用,用于诊断、调试和统计程序运行,本文将详细介绍它的使用方法及实践案例。当程序运行异常或系统命令出错而难以通过常规手段定位问题时,strace就能派上用场。
当遇到操作系统运维中程序失败、报错信息无法揭示问题根源时,strace能够让我们在无需内核或代码的情况下,跟踪系统调用过程。它是一种不可或缺的诊断工具,系统管理员只需简单操作,即可在不查看源代码的情况下跟踪系统的调用。
strace的参数选项众多,如在CentOS/EulerOS和Ubuntu系统中安装,以及常用参数如 `-c` 用于统计系统调用时间、次数和错误次数,`-d` 显示调试输出,`-p` 根据进程ID追踪等。例如,通过`-e trace=open,close,read,write` 可以追踪ls命令中的文件系统调用,或者通过`-p`跟踪特定进程的系统活动。
以解决“无法解析域名”问题为例,我们可以通过strace命令查看系统在读取文件时的调用情况,如发现缺失了/lib/libnss_dns.so.2文件,说明问题可能出在相关库文件上。解决方法是安装glibc-devel包以获取缺失的文件。
通过strace,我们不仅能解决系统问题,还能深入了解系统的运作机制,提高运维效率。希望这些实例和参数帮助你更好地利用strace进行Linux系统调用的追踪和调试。
FFmpeg开发笔记(七)欧拉系统编译安装FFmpeg
FFmpeg是一款功能强大的多媒体编码和解码工具,支持Linux、macOS、Windows、Android等操作系统,如Ubuntu、Debian、Mint、CentOS、RHEL、Fedora等分支。
在CentOS上编译安装FFmpeg涉及一系列步骤,确保工具包的安装,然后单独安装NASM、Yasm、libx、libx、libfdk_aac、libmp3lame、libopus、libvpx等依赖库。接着,配置并安装libx、libx、libfdk_aac等关键库,最后编译安装FFmpeg。具体步骤包括使用git下载源码,配置编译选项,执行make和make install命令,确保所有依赖正确安装。
对于EulerOS(欧拉系统),基于CentOS源码开发,运行环境兼容CentOS。在欧拉系统上编译安装FFmpeg,同样需要安装一些基础工具和依赖库,如nasm、g++、openssl-devel、curl-devel、cmake、git等。接下来,下载并编译x、x和FFmpeg源码包,使用特定命令配置编译选项,并完成make和make install操作。最终,通过执行ffmpeg -version命令验证FFmpeg安装成功。
通过遵循上述步骤,用户可以在不同操作系统如CentOS和EulerOS上成功编译安装FFmpeg,实现多媒体编码和解码功能。
openeuler是否基于linux详情
1、openEuler是一款开源操作系统当前openEuler内核源于Linux,支持鲲鹏及其它多种处理器,能够充分释放计算芯片的潜能,是由全球开源贡献者构建的高效稳定安全的开源操作系统,适用于数据库大数据云计算人工智能等应用场景。
2、EulerOS,以Linux稳定系统内核为基础,支持鲲鹏处理器和容器虚拟化技术,是一个面向企业级的通用服务器架构平台年9月,华为推出openEuler欧拉操作系统优势高性能EulerOS提供CPU多核加速技术高性能虚拟化容器技术等。
3、openSUSE 是一款免费稳定易用基于Linux的多功能操作系统 它适用于PC笔记本以及服务器有 4Mandriva Linux OS Mandriva Linux是来自Mandriva的终极版Linux操作系统它是三种技术融合的结晶Mandriva,Conectiva和Lyco。
4、几乎所有国产电脑操作系统都是基于Linux的比如深度Linux,优麒麟,中标麒麟,威科乐恩,起点操作系统,凝思磐石安全操作系统,共创Linux,思普操作系统,中科方德桌面操作系统,普华Linux,RTThread RTOS,中兴新支点操作系统,一铭。
5、是的,这个是谷歌公司在Linux的基础上开发的现在华为的鸿蒙也是的好处就是开源Linux就该这么学有Linux命令。
6、Android是基于Linux内核的,但是它与Linux之间是有差别的,比如Android在Linux内核的基础上添加了自己所特有的驱动程序至于安卓为什么会选择Linux有五点1强大的内存管理和进程管理方案 2基于权限的安全模式 3。
7、windows系统不是基于linux的Microsoft Windows操作系统是美国微软公司研发的一套操作系统,它问世于年,起初仅仅是MicrosoftDOS模拟环境,后续的系统版本由于微软不断的更新升级,不但易用,也慢慢的成为家家户户人们最喜爱。
8、Android是一种基于Linux的自由及开放源代码的操作系统主要使用于移动设备,如智能手机和平板电脑,由Google公司和开放手机联盟领导及开发尚未有统一中文名称,中国大陆地区较多人使用“安卓”Android操作系统最初由Andy Rubin。
9、苹果系统IOS系统是基于unix的,但是加入了自己的东西成了一个独立的系统,是Darwin为基础的Darwin本身就是一个完整的UNIXBSD系统,具有UNIX体系惯有的高度可靠性和健壮性Darwin项目的创始公司是苹果公司,但Darwin完全。
、系统是基于Linux的,Andorid是Linux嵌入式开发的只是接口之类的是基于java的,编程语言是javaAndroid基于Linux 内核的 操作系统,是 Google公司在年月5 日公布的 手机操作系统,早期由Google开发,后由开放手持设备。
、没有压根就没有国产的操作系统当然如果你说那种番茄花园,老毛桃等也是属于的话,那就有。
、LiteOS不是基于linux吧,LiteOS是华为自主推出的物联网操作系统,具备开放的API,屏蔽底层差异,良好的兼容性使得已熟悉Linux系统上开发应用的开发者,能够非常平滑的切换到Huawei LiteOS系统上开发。
、是的,linux核心源代码是开放的,绝对的完全免费OS指系统,ui指界面华为的emui,小米的miui都是基于安卓内核对界面进行修改也正是楼主所说的“基于安卓开发”然而谷歌的Android OS,苹果的I os这些就是指独立的系统了。
、WINDOWS本身属于微内核系统,WINDOWS总共大概不到万行代码,而WINDOWS则已经有余万行代码,其中%是用C++编写,其余部分有C和汇编,底层接口用汇编编写WINDOWS操作系统本身是微内核系统,所以扩展性及以后的维护要求。
、Linux是源于UNIX想必你也知道UNIX是一类系统的统称,宏内核架构,有自己的约定俗成的实现标准,比如系统调用的方式最为经典的UNIX系统就是SUN公司的Solaris,是UNIX所有特性的集合体Linux是沿袭了UNIX的内核架构和系统实现。
、高性能,高安全,高可用,可扩展,强实时 国内安全等级最高的操作系统 世界上第一个通过美国自由标准化组织LSB认证的非Linux内核操作系统 银河麒麟服务器操作系统主要特点如下以上是我在麒麟官方网站找到相关信息国内基于LIUNX。